Homemade Marshmallow Easter Eggs are not only fun to make, and a great activity to do with the kids over the Easter holidays, they are also a handy option to have for those with food intolerances.
While we dipped ours in chocolate, you can easily make yours dairy free. Jazz up the marshmallow by decorating with royal icing or dip the eggs in 'candy melts' for a dairy-free, non-chocolate option that still ticks all the boxes.
Get experimental by colouring your marshmallow and flavouring according to taste.
Any excess marshmallow can be poured into a wet pan, left to set, then cut into shapes with wet cookie cutters.
